**Runbook: migrating Duskforge to hermetic builds**

New team members: all Duskforge targets must declare deps explicitly; no network access during build. Vendored toolchains live in the Ashgrove registry. If a target fails hermetically but passes locally, you have an undeclared dep — fix the manifest, don't add escape hatches. Verify output hashes match across two machines. The reference build token follows below.

session token of tajef-bageg = htk21_5d90d574934f3ccae6437

- [ ] Step 7: Archive cold storage buckets (Glacierline tier). Confirm both ceremony witnesses are present, verify bucket manifests match the Oxbow ledger, then seal the archive key shares. Plugin authors may observe but not handle shares. Once sealed, the archive index itself is encrypted and can only be reopened with the passphrase below.

vault phrase of badup-hahig = tamael-aldael-kelmir-istael-fenok-istwyn-tamius-jorath-oliion

# MAX_NESTED_BLOCKQUOTES caps blockquote depth in the Inkrill
# markdown pipeline. Deeper nesting caused quadratic re-parse
# passes in the sanitizer stage and, in one pathological doc,
# a 40-second render. Raise this only with a matching change to
# the sanitizer's iterative walker. The regression was first
# reproduced under the build referenced below.

pipeline stamp: htk21_104c5ba7d0df6b2897cd5